The twelfth coin from this amazingly popular series is struck from 1oz of 99.9% pure silver in proof quality and features the Elephant Seal.
The Southern Elephant Seal is the largest seal in the world and the largest member of the order Carnivora, which includes all seals, cats and dogs, raccoons and foxes, wolves and hyenas, bears, and weasels and civets, among others.
Each coin is struck by The Perth Mint from 1oz of 99.9% pure silver in proof quality.
The coin’s coloured reverse depicts a roaring Elephant Seal sitting on land within an outline of Antarctica. As well as the inscription 2015 ELEPHANT SEAL, the design also includes the words ‘Australian Antarctic Territory’ and The Perth Mint’s traditional ‘P’ mintmark.
Issued as legal tender under the Australian Currency Act 1965, the Ian Rank-Broadley effigy of Her Majesty Queen Elizabeth II, and the monetary denomination are depicted on the coin’s obverse.
The Perth Mint will release no more than 7,500 of the Australian Antarctic Territory Series – Elephant Seal 2015 1oz Silver Proof Coin.
The coin is housed in a classic charcoal-coloured presentation case, which comes within a stylish outer shipper. Each coin is accompanied by a numbered Certificate of Authenticity.
